    Quote Originally Posted by Gatts:
    It's interesting to note that pre-handover Deng Xiaoping stated he did not want any PLA troops stationed in HK. Unfortunately he and the party changed their mind by '97.
    They even sent troops into Macau upon its handover in 1999, which was a bit controversial because Macau hadn't had any military presence since 1974.
